The Research Foundation for Mental Hygiene is seeking a qualified candidate to fill a full-time as a Technical Support/Administrative Aide needed for customer service for the Center for Practice Innovations (CPI) and user support on CPI's Learning Management System (LMS).
The CPI works with state agencies, local government agencies, and over 1,000 provider agencies across NY State. Its mission is to promote the widespread availability of evidence-based practices to improve mental health services, ensure accountability, and promote recovery-oriented outcomes for consumers and families. To help promote training in evidence-based practices, the Center uses a learning management system, a web-based e-learning platform used to administer, document, track, and report training.
